so the popping sound is still there even when your chain is not on the bike or it's not being pedaled? Sounds like you just need a new BB bearing, or bearings. Take the cranks off and pull the spindle out and try to spin the bearing with your finger, if you can't or they're very hard to turn, then you need new bearings. If you can spin them but they feel notchy, you can try greasing them and seeing if that makes the problem go away, but it sounds like one or both of the bearings could be shot

Sounds like the tube spacer isn't long enough so your bearings have taken too much lateral pressure. Regreasing them won't help as they'll already be worn. Loosen a crank arm and see if the noise goes away/they spin easier. If it does, put extra spacing inbetween the bearings
